How to Become a Chef in Los Angeles

Successful chefs and culinary artists in Los Angeles usually begin their careers with a high school diploma, which is a prerequisite for most programs.

GED test results can be used in the place of a high school diploma.

It is common for chefs to choose between a campus program and an online program for their actual training. Attending a certificate or associate degree program can also lead to success.

All chefs in the city are expected to have a food handler license for safety purposes.

Los Angeles Trade Technical College

Los Angeles, CA Campus Only

Los Angeles Trade Technical College provides several culinary arts pathways for interested individuals in the city and across the state. These include top-quality programs such as Associate of Arts degree programs in Baking, Culinary Arts, and Restaurant Management.

Riverside City College

Riverside, CA Campus Only

Riverside City College offers a Culinary Arts program designed to prepare students for careers in the food service industry. The program provides hands-on training in cooking techniques, food preparation, and kitchen management. Students will learn essential skills such as knife handling, baking, international cuisine, and sanitation practices.
